What shape strikes your fancy? Milan Fashion Week ran the gamut for Fall 2012, from way out-there funkiness to the classic platform boot to the S&M-tinged ladylike pump. Whether you’re in the business of pleasure or taking pleasure in business, the new season is shaping up to suit you. Which of these three very different silhouettes speaks to your feet?

1) Prada: The curvy, swervy heel of this past year is not going anywhere! Remember Lady Miss Kier from Deee-Lite in the early nineties? Well, it looks like groove is back in the heart. These wacky platform Mary Janes will either speak to you or not – there’s no middle ground here. They’re a little witchy in their exaggerated shape, but I have to admit: they kind of make me want to get up and dance.

2) Moschino: Fun, flirty, and actually wearable! Ever-playful Moschino delivered hot-to-trot ankle boots and strap-happy Mary Janes, with just enough gold, military-esque hardware and just enough platform layers that will go with everything come fall. Especially the brand’s mix-and-match black-and-white checks and sporty paneled leggings.

3) Etro: Etro delivered simultaneous structure and softness. Leather peplums, shots of fur, classical paisley prints, and panels of velvet were all in the mix, but it was the shoes that were the most sensual. The mix of corset-tight laces and pointy-toed satin is undeniably sexy, and an olive croc-embossed boot is a no-brainer to strap on. These are high-heels for the grown woman; girls interested in playtime need not apply.
